Mickleham, Victoria, Australia

Overview

Mickleham, a rapidly growing suburb in Victoria, Australia, is known for its new developments, family-friendly estates, and expansive green spaces. Offering easy access to Melbourne while maintaining a suburban charm, it's popular with young families and professionals seeking a relaxed pace of life.

Best Time to Visit

November to April for warm, dry summer weather and local community events.

Local Tips

Public transport options are limited, so renting a car is recommended. Mickleham's estates often host weekend markets and community gatherings.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ping is not compulsory but appreciated for excellent service. Dress is casual, though smart casual is expected in nicer restaurants. Australians are friendly but value personal space.

Safety Warnings

Mickleham is generally safe, but be cautious in isolated park areas after dark and secure your vehicle and belongings to avoid opportunistic theft.

Hidden Gems

Explore the lesser-known Malcolm Creek trails, Annandale community markets, and local farm-gate produce stalls that embody the suburb's welcoming spirit.
